If a minivan or SUV just doesn't cut it for your everyday demands,
never forget the venerable full-size van.
Three major manufacturers still produce full-sized vans for the
American market: Ford, Daimler-Chrysler and General Motors. Of all of
the full-sized vans sold in the United States, nearly half are
purchased for commercial use, but there is still a viable consumer
market out there for the big boys.
Here are some capsule descriptions of some of the best sellers in
the full-size van line:
